How Much Does a Surrogate Cost?
Undertaking the journey of surrogacy in the USA may require significant financial considerations. The comprehensive cost of surrogacy can vary widely depending on several influences, including the geographic area where the procedure takes place, the experience and qualifications of the medical team involved, and the type of surrogacy arrangement chosen. On average, surrogacy in the USA read more falls between approximately $100,000 to $150,000. However, it's important to remember that this is just a broad estimate, and your individual costs may be higher or lower.
- Numerous factors can affect the final cost of surrogacy, including legal fees, agency commissions, medical expenses, and surrogate compensation.

The Price of American Surrogacy: What to Expect
Navigating the complexities of surrogacy requires careful consideration, and understanding the associated costs is paramount. In the United States, surrogate pregnancies can range significantly in price, influenced by a myriad of variables. Legal expenses, medical expenses, and compensation for the surrogate woman are all crucial components.
On average, a surrogacy journey in the US can cost anywhere from $50,000 to $150,000. This difference often results from diverse situations, such as the surrogate's experience level, the chosen location, and the extent of the medical procedures.
